Nene Park Trust
Nene Park TrustNene Park is a large area of park land to the west of Peterborough and is the region's favourite place to get outdoors and enjoy nature. It is made up of six different areas: Ferry Meadows, Orton Meadows, Orton Mere, Woodston Reach, Thorpe Meadows and The Rural Estate made up of parkland, meadows, woodlands and lakes. Oundle International Festival
OundleOundle International Festival is a professional music festival held each July in Oundle and the surrounding area. Oundle International Festival has attracted a growing audience from the local community, and further afield with a programme that includes jazz, folk and world music alongside classical repertoire, and related programming in other art forms.
